Marathon residents reminded to abide by Bylaw No. 1788

stock photo

MARATHON—Pet safety is of prime importance to pet owners, pet families and the Municipality of Marathon.

In a recent notice, residents were reminded to abide by Bylaw No. 1788 which mandates that, “No owner of a dog shall permit the dog to run at large in the town.”

According to the municipality, “Keeping your dog on a leash provides safety for other people, other animals and your own dog.”

Failure to abide by this could result in a fine of $150.
